Sample Answer
As we look to the future, it is highly probable that homes will undergo significant transformations, largely driven by advancements in technology and a growing emphasis on sustainability. For instance, we might witness the proliferation of smart homes, where domestic appliances and systems are interconnected, allowing for greater energy efficiency and convenience. Moreover, the integration of renewable energy sources, such as solar panels, may become ubiquitous, enabling households to reduce their carbon footprint significantly. Additionally, the design of homes could evolve to accommodate flexible living spaces, reflecting a shift in societal norms towards remote work and multi-generational living. Furthermore, newly emerging materials that are eco-friendly and highly durable could redefine construction methods, leading to not just homes that are aesthetically pleasing, but also resilient in the face of climate change.
